China responded to their earlier disappointment with a 4-1 victory over Singapore in their return FIFA World Cup qualification (AFC) match on March 26, 2024, at the Tianjin Olympic Center Stadium. After being held to a 2-2 draw in Singapore, the Chinese team delivered a much-improved performance, kicking off at 20:00 and taking control of the game with two first-half goals. They extended their lead after the break, and although Singapore grabbed a late consolation, China added a fourth to seal a convincing win. This result was essential for China's qualifying campaign, restoring confidence and keeping their hopes of progression alive in a competitive group.
